Recognizing Low-VOC Paints



When you pick low-VOC paints, you're choosing an item that releases fewer volatile natural substances, which can be unsafe to both your health and the atmosphere.



VOCs are chemicals located in several paint items that can vaporize into the air and add to indoor air contamination. By choosing low-VOC alternatives, you're decreasing the number of these discharges, making your space more secure.

Potential Drawbacks to Take Into Consideration



While low-VOC paints offer numerous benefits, there are some prospective downsides to remember. One significant concern is their efficiency compared to typical paints. Low-VOC alternatives may not constantly provide the exact same degree of resilience and coverage, which can cause even more frequent touch-ups or a requirement for extra coats. An additional problem is the drying time. Low-VOC paints commonly take longer to dry than their high-VOC equivalents, which can expand your project timeline. If residential home painters on a limited schedule, this might be a disadvantage to think about.
